Window Well Installation in Olathe, KS

Window well installation services involve adding protective enclosures outside basement windows to improve safety, drainage, and accessibility. These structures are typically used in properties with below-grade windows to prevent soil and debris from blocking the window opening, reduce the risk of water infiltration, and provide a safe means of egress in case of emergency. Projects can range from installing new window wells during basement finishing or remodeling to replacing or upgrading existing wells that have become damaged or ineffective.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ance basement safety, improve drainage around the foundation, and ensure compliance with building codes for emergency exits.

Before requesting window well installation, property owners should consider the size and material of the well, the type of cover needed, and the drainage solutions required for their property. It’s also helpful to evaluate the condition of existing window wells, if any, and determine whether additional features such as ladders or lighting are desired. Understanding the location of underground utilities and ensuring proper excavation and support are important steps in planning a successful installation. Clear communication about project goals and property specifics can help ensure the chosen solution effectively meets safety, drainage, and aesthetic needs.

FAQ

Window Well Installation Questions

What is the purpose of installing a window well? Window wells provide protection against flooding and allow natural light into basement windows, enhancing safety and visibility.

What types of window well materials are available? Common options include steel, plastic, and concrete, each offering durability and different aesthetic choices.

Can window wells be customized to fit different window sizes? Yes, window wells can be tailored to match various window dimensions and property specifications.

Are there maintenance considerations for window wells? Regular clearing of debris and ensuring proper drainage help maintain functionality and prevent water issues.
